Israeli occupation forces shoot dead Palestinian citizen of Tubas

September 07, 2022

Israeli occupation soldiers killed a young Palestinian man in the Al-Far’a refugee camp, south of Tubas, in the northeastern West Bank, Palestine's Health Ministry confirmed.

The Ministry said the Israeli occupation soldiers shot Younis Ghassan Tayeh, 21, with a live round in his heart, critically injuring him, before he was announced dead later.

The Israeli occupation soldiers invaded the refugee camp, leading to protests, and attacked the Palestinians with dozens of live rounds, rubber-coated steel bullets, gas bombs, and concussion grenades.

The occupying soldiers also stormed and ransacked the family home of the slain Palestinian and interrogated his family members.
